1Prince.
2Doe not thinke so, you shall not finde it so:
3And Heauen forgiue them, that so much haue sway'd
4Your Maiesties good thoughts away from me:
5I will redeeme all this on Percies head,
6And in the closing of some glorious day,
7Be bold to tell you, that I am your Sonne,
8When I will weare a Garment all of Blood,
